Educational Grants And Competitions

Educational grants and competitions are initiatives designed to support students, educators, and academic institutions through financial aid, recognition, and opportunities to showcase their work. These programs aim to promote learning, innovation, and excellence in various educational fields by providing resources and incentives for achievement.

Key Features

  • Financial support through grants or scholarships
  • Recognition and awards for outstanding projects or research
  • Opportunities for networking and collaboration among participants
  • Promotion of innovation, creativity, and academic excellence
  • Wide range of disciplines and levels, from K-12 to higher education

Pros

  • Provides valuable financial assistance to students and educators
  • Encourages innovation and excellence in education
  • Increases motivation for academic achievement
  • Offers opportunities for recognition and career advancement
  • Fosters collaboration and knowledge sharing among participants

Cons

  • Highly competitive, making it difficult for some applicants to succeed
  • Complex application processes can be time-consuming
  • Limited funding may not reach all deserving candidates
  • Potential regional or institutional biases in award distributions
  • Some programs may have restrictive eligibility criteria
